HEALTH CAREERS


This site is intended as a resource for Sacramento State students who are considering a career as a health professional. Deciding on a specific health care career and preparing to be admitted to a health professional school are very difficult tasks. Many professional schools in health (e.g., Medicine) welcome a variety of majors and perspectives, some health professions (e.g. PT or Nursing) are often associated with a specific major department. If you think you know the health career for you, or are unsure of your path, use this site as a way of exploring professions and finding resources that can help you prepare for a career that fits.

  • Central Valley Health Network is offering pre-health students at Sacramento State an opportunity to witness first-hand the work that occurs at our local health centers.  CVHN is a consortium of several Federally Qualified Health Center corporations. Our health centers provide medical services and health outreach to low-income populations throughout California’s Central Valley. This coming year, we will be holding tours at a few of our health care facilities for pre-health students or those who are already on track to becoming a health professional. We think that this is a great opportunity for students to have honest exposure to a health care setting and the many people who work together to make it run efficiently. Students who participated in the public health tour before have said that the experience was informative and rewarding. We have previously offered this opportunity to UC Davis students only, and would now like to expand the project and offer it to more schools.
